The Branigan Cultural Center, 501 N. Main St., will offer a variety of programs and exhibits in March. The schedule of activities includes:

Exhibit Opening and Craft Activity

Lucha Libre: Stories from the Ring

5 p.m. to 8 p.m. Friday, March 6, 2020. The craft activity will be from 5:30 p.m. to 6:30 p.m.

Lucha Libre: Stories from the Ring is an exhibition that opens Friday, March 6, 2020 and will continue through Saturday, June 30, 2020. This exhibit features the rich history of lucha libre that includes theatre, athleticism, dance, story, folk heroes, and the visual arts. Attendees for the opening reception will have the opportunity to decorate their own mask to take home after touring this new exhibition.

History Notes: The History of Camp Cody with Jim Eckles

1 p.m. to 2 p.m. Thursday, March 12, 2020 at the Branigan Cultural Center

Jim Eckles presents the history of Camp Cody from 1 p.m. to 2 p.m. Thursday, March 12. Learn about the history of this early 20th century military training camp at Deming, New Mexico. Jim Eckles is a local historian and retiree from White Sands Missile Range where he worked for 30 years. His research into Camp Cody opened the door to an all but forgotten chapter in southern New Mexico’s World War I history.
